How does Lower Nazareth's soil affect my fence material choice?
The township's moderate soil corrosivity index and moderate termite risk dictate material compatibility. Pressure-treated pine requires proper ground-contact ratings. For metal posts and hardware, use h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ks and structural weakening. Material failure here is a chemical process, not just wear.
What is the first step before you start digging?
You must contact Pennsylvania 811 for a utility locate. Hitting a gas, electric, or fiber line in Lower Nazareth Township is a major liability causing service outages, fines, and repair costs. Am I legally required to talk to my neighbor before replacing our shared fence in Lower Nazareth?
Yes. Under Pennsylvania's Fence Law (Title 29) and common local ordinance, a shared 'partition fence' is a joint property line structure. You must provide written notice to the adjoining owner in Lower Nazareth before construction begins. This 2026 standard prevents disputes and clarifies maintenance responsibility.
Why do you dig fence post holes so deep in Lower Nazareth Township?
IRC Section R403 mandates footings extend below the frost line. Lower Nazareth's 40-inch frost line means posts set shallower will heave during freeze-thaw cycles. This destabilizes the entire fence line, leading to premature failure and repair costs. Proper depth is a non-negotiable structural requirement.
Is a standard fence strong enough for our area's storms?
No. Lower Nazareth's 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ating under ASCE 7-22 standards dictates engineering. A generic fence will fail. We calculate post spacing, concrete footing mass, and bracket strength to resist peak storm season gusts. The design load is a mathematical requirement, not a suggestion.
Can I have a smart gate if I have a pool?
Yes, but integration is key. IRC Appendix AG requires pool barriers to have self-closing, self-latching gates. A modern IoT gate system must have these mechanical features as primary, with smart access as a secondary control. This dual-layer design meets Pennsylvania liability standards for unattended operation and child safety.
What are the fence height rules for my Lower Nazareth property?
Lower Nazareth Township zoning typically enforces a 4-foot height limit in front yards and a 6-foot limit in rear yards. The 0-foot setback allows building directly on your property line. Critical: corner lots must maintain clear 'sight triangles' at intersections, especially near high-traffic corridors like PA-33, where visibility is a safety imperative.
